What is a Cheongsam? A cheongsam, also known as a qipao in Chinese culture, is a traditional Chinese dress that has been worn for centuries. It typically consists of a fitted bodice with a loose skirt that flows gracefully. Cheongsam designs come in various styles and colors, making it an excellent choice for babies and toddlers.

Why Choose a Cheongsam for Winter? During the colder months, a cheongsam can provide your baby with warmth and comfort while still maintaining its elegance and style. Many modern cheongsam designs come with layers of fabric and thermal lining to keep your little one cozy. Additionally, the traditional design allows for easy movement, ensuring your baby remains comfortable throughout the day.

Choosing the Right Cheongsam for Your Baby When selecting a cheongsam for your baby, consider their age, size, and comfort level. Here are some factors to keep in mind:

  1. Age: Cheongsam designs come in various sizes, catering to babies of different ages. Look for designs that are suitable for your baby's age group, ensuring they are safe and comfortable to wear.

  2. Size: It's essential to choose a cheongsam that fits your baby comfortably. Look for elastic waistbands and adjustable straps to ensure a perfect fit. Avoid cheongsam designs that are too tight or too loose, which can cause discomfort or pose safety risks.

  3. Comfort: The material of the cheongsam is crucial. Look for fabrics that are warm, breathable, and skin-friendly to ensure your baby remains comfortable throughout the day. Avoid cheongsam designs with harsh materials or embellishments that could irritate your baby's skin.

Styling Your Baby's Cheongsam When styling your baby's cheongsam, consider their personality and the occasion you're dressing them for. Here are some tips:

  1. Match the occasion: Cheongsam designs come in various styles and colors, catering to different occasions. For formal events, choose a classic design with elegant colors and details. For everyday wear, opt for more casual designs with bright colors or patterns that reflect your baby's personality.

  2. Layer up: To keep your baby warm during colder weather, layer their cheongsam with a warm jacket or sweater. Look for jackets with soft fabrics and thermal lining to ensure your baby remains cozy.

  3. Accessories: Add some finishing touches to your baby's look by pairing their cheongsam with cute accessories such as hats, boots, or scarves. Choose accessories made of warm and comfortable materials to keep your baby cozy during colder weather.

Maintaining Your Baby's Cheongsam To keep your baby's cheongsam clean and in good condition, follow these tips:

  1. Hand wash: Cheongsam fabrics are often delicate and prone to damage from harsh machines or chemicals. Hand wash your baby's cheongsam using a mild detergent and cold water to preserve its quality and color.

  2. Air dry: Avoid using a dryer to preserve the texture and color of the cheongsam. Instead, air dry it in a well-ventilated area, away from direct sunlight.

  3. Store properly: To prevent damage or fading, store your baby's cheongsam in a cool and dry place, away from direct sunlight or heat sources.
